Bulgarian
Alternative forms
Etymology
From току́ (tokú, “just (now)”) + що (što). (This etymology is missing or incomplete. Please add to it, or discuss it at the Etymology scriptorium. Particularly: “Meaning of the що element?”)
Pronunciation
Adverb
току́-що́ • (tokú-štó) (not comparable)
- just now; recently
